Summary
- Dr. Edwin Abraham, MD is a board certified anesthesiologist in Chattanooga, Tennessee. He is currently licensed to practice medicine in Tennessee and Arkansas. He is affiliated with Erlanger Medical Center and is an Assistant Professor at University of Arkansas COM.
